Ba₂OsO₄ is a barium osmium oxide ceramic compound belonging to the family of mixed-metal oxides. This material is primarily of research and specialized industrial interest, valued for its high density and thermal stability, with potential applications in environments requiring chemically resistant and thermally robust ceramic phases. Due to its osmium content, Ba₂OsO₄ is considered an advanced functional ceramic rather than a commodity material, and its use is typically limited to high-performance applications where cost justifies the incorporation of rare transition metals.
